The gate is 7.5 meters high and 25 meters wide. Its shape refers to the coat of arms of Odolanów established in 1990 (an open white brick gate, with a two-stage tower ending with a triangular blue roof in the upper part). The gate-monument at the front will feature figures symbolizing the four seasons, St. Martin (the city's patron saint) and eight medallions with eighteen scenes depicting the history and contemporary times of Odolanów and Poland. There are also two commemorative plaques with 49 dates from the history of the town on the Barycz River.
